Specifications and performanceThe SPLIT Set stabilizer is a slotted steel tube,with one end tapered for easy insertion into a drillhole. The other end has a welded ring flange tohold the bearing stabilizer is inserted into a hole slightlysmaller in diameter than the tube, using a simpledriver tool fitted to the drill. As the tube enters, itsdiameter is compressed and the slot partiallycloses. This exerts radial forces along the length ofcontact with the rock, providing the friction whichholds the rock together. The driving force of the drillactively loads the bearing plate against the Rollforms SPLIT Sets feature apatented Ring Indexing feature. This allows fordetermining the length of an installed SPLIT and plates are available standard orgalvanized, made in accordance with ASTM F 432-95 where applicable.
